Hmmm.. Not sure what exact Mac this is 13" running Tahoe— maybe you can be more exact, must be an M-series


I suspect you are referring to the built in screen; no external monitor involved.


Have you shut down and restarted..?

>Shut down


no resolve—

A SafeBoot https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T201262 will sort many anomalies


Login and test. Reboot as normal and test. Caches get rebuilt automatically.



If this is Intel 13" Mac..(?)



Try resetting the System Management Controller https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T201295


Try resetting NVRAM/PRAM http://support.apple.com/kb/ht1379

(get at least two-three rounds of the chimes when holding the NVRAM Reset)




your 26.3 is the current up to date macOS...


Is this a new issue when going from 26.2 to the point-update 26.3 ? Or an ongoing issue?
